- ISBN:9787111682295
- 装帧:一般胶版纸
- 册数:暂无
- 重量:暂无
- 开本:16开
- 页数:187
- 出版时间:2021-07-01
- 条形码:9787111682295 ; 978-7-111-68229-5
内容简介
程序设计是学习计算机类专业的学生必须掌握的一项基本技能。 本书以实际案例为引领,以创新能力培养为主线,将课程知识体系整合,在内容的组织中注意体现学生设计能力培养的循序渐进性。本书从初学者的角度,以形象的比喻、实用的案例、通俗易懂的语言详细介绍了C语言编程的内容和技巧。本书共10篇,其中篇主要介绍了C语言的发展史、特点和开发环境CFree 5.0。第2~5篇主要讲解了C语言的数据类型与表达式、基本结构、数组、函数等基础知识。第6~9篇是C语言的提高部分,主要讲解了指针、字符串、结构体与共用体和文件等核心内容。0篇为综合项目——学生成绩管理系统。本书附有配套的源代码、习题、教学课件、教学大纲等资源,可在机工教育网下载。本书适合作为职业院校相关专业程序设计类课程的教材,还可以作为从事程序设计、程序开发等行业人员的参考书籍。
目录
目录contents
前言
第1篇概述
1.1C语言的历史和特点00
1.2C语言的编译环境与程序结构00
习题00
第2篇数据类型与表达式
2.1初出茅庐——数据结构0
2.2小试牛刀——赋值语句0
2.3深入学习——数据的输入、输出0
2.4运算新认识——运算符和表达式0
习题0
第3篇结构化设计
3.1按部就班——顺序结构0
3.2择机而动——单分支选择结构0
3.3鱼和熊掌不可兼得——双分支选择结构0
3.4条条道路通罗马——多分支选择结构0
3.5小试牛刀——实例解析0
3.6周而复始——while循环结构0
3.7循环往复——dowhile循环结构0
3.8反而复还——for循环结构0
3.9循环不息——循环嵌套0
习题0
第4篇数组
4.1一维数组的引入0
4.2一维数组——排序0
4.3由浅入深——二维数组0
4.4循序渐进——实例解析0
习题0
第5篇函数
5.1程序的细胞——函数0
5.2循环利用——递归调用0
5.3变量也分级别——变量作用域0
习题
第6篇指针
6.1初出茅庐——认识指针
6.2指针的运用
6.3指向数组的指针变量
习题
第7篇字符串
7.1文本信息表达——字符数组
7.2文本信息表达——字符串
7.3文本信息表达——字符指针
7.4文本信息好帮手——字符串输入/输出
7.5使用库函数——字符串函数
习题
第8篇结构体与共用体
8.1数据的“封装”——结构体
8.2“批量生产”数据——结构体数组
8.3内存共享——共用体
习题
第9篇文件
9.1基于字符编码——文本文件
9.2基于值编码——二进制文件
习题
第10篇综合项目——学生成绩管理系统
10.1项目分析
10.2项目设计与实现
10.3项目总结
附录
附录AASCII码表
附录B运算符的优先级和结合性
附录C常用ANSIC标准库函数
参考文献
-
造神:人工智能神话的起源和破除 (精装)
¥32.7¥88.0 -
硅谷之火-人与计算机的未来
¥15.5¥39.8 -
过程控制技术(第2版高职高专规划教材)
¥27.6¥38.0 -
专业导演教你拍好短视频
¥13.8¥39.9 -
系统性创新手册(管理版)
¥42.6¥119.0 -
计算机网络技术
¥25.7¥33.0 -
深入浅出软件架构
¥117.2¥186.0 -
软件设计的哲学(第2版)
¥54.0¥69.8 -
大数据技术导论(第2版)
¥28.9¥41.0 -
人工智能的底层逻辑
¥55.3¥79.0 -
剪映+PREMIERE+AIGC 短视频制作速成
¥73.5¥98.0 -
人人都能学AI
¥39.8¥68.0 -
剪映AI
¥52.0¥88.0 -
数据挖掘技术与应用
¥46.0¥75.0 -
数据采集与处理
¥36.4¥49.8 -
PLC结构化文本编程(第2版)
¥56.3¥79.0 -
中小型网络组建与管理
¥30.7¥43.0 -
上海市老年教育推荐用书:老年人智慧生活(进阶篇)
¥32.5¥45.0 -
上海市老年教育推荐用书:老年人智慧生活(初级篇)
¥29.3¥45.0 -
SOLIDWORKS中文版实用教程
¥104.9¥149.9